Explanation

• Biochemical Oxygen Demand is an important water quality parameter which provides an index to assess the effect discharged wastewater will have on the receiving environment. • The higher the BOD value, the greater the amount of organic matter or food available for oxygen consuming bacteria. http://www.civilsdaily.com/pib-rivers-under-national-river-conservation-programme-whats-that/
